Searched defs:flt_addr (Results 1 - 21 of 21) sorted by relevance

/illumos-gate/usr/src/uts/sun4u/taco/os/
H A Dtaco.c208 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
212 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4u/littleneck/os/
H A Dlittleneck.c147 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
151 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4u/chicago/os/
H A Dchicago.c159 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
163 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4u/enchilada/os/
H A Denchilada.c206 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
210 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4u/excalibur/os/
H A Dexcalibur.c183 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
187 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4u/schumacher/os/
H A Dschumacher.c189 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
193 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4/sys/
H A Dasync.h69 uint64_t flt_addr; /* async fault address register */ member in struct:async_flt
192 * Invalid or unknown physical address for async_flt.flt_addr.
/illumos-gate/usr/src/uts/sun4u/boston/os/
H A Dboston.c252 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
256 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4u/seattle/os/
H A Dseattle.c255 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
259 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4u/cherrystone/os/
H A Dcherrystone.c546 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
550 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4u/cpu/
H A Dmach_cpu_module.c123 cpu_get_mem_offset(uint64_t flt_addr, uint64_t *offp) argument
H A Dopl_olympus.c1075 page_retire_check(aflt->flt_addr, NULL) == 0) {
1080 softcall(ecc_page_zero, (void *)aflt->flt_addr);
1135 (void) page_retire(aflt->flt_addr, PR_UE);
1206 uint64_t flt_addr, int flt_bus_id, int flt_in_memory,
1218 if ((ret = plat_get_mem_unum(synd_code, flt_addr, flt_bus_id,
1244 aflt->flt_addr, aflt->flt_bus_id, aflt->flt_in_memory,
1388 DATA_TYPE_UINT64, aflt->flt_addr, NULL);
1465 pf_is_memory(aflt->flt_addr >> MMU_PAGESHIFT));
1581 de.fme_bus_specific = (void *)aflt->flt_addr;
1941 aflt->flt_addr
1205 cpu_get_mem_unum(int synd_status, ushort_t flt_synd, uint64_t flt_stat, uint64_t flt_addr, int flt_bus_id, int flt_in_memory, ushort_t flt_status, char *buf, int buflen, int *lenp) argument
2331 cpu_get_mem_offset(uint64_t flt_addr, uint64_t *offp) argument
[all...]
H A Dspitfire.c381 #define CPU_AFAR 0x0040 /* print flt_addr as %afar */
841 ecc->flt_addr = t_afar;
848 (pf_is_memory(ecc->flt_addr >> MMU_PAGESHIFT)) ? 1: 0;
883 if (page_retire_check(ecc->flt_addr, NULL) == 0) {
905 ecc->flt_addr = t_afar | 0x8; /* Sabres do not have a UDBL */
1005 * It is possible that the flt_addr is not a valid
1024 scrubphys(P2ALIGN(ecc->flt_addr, 64),
1095 (void) page_retire(ecc->flt_addr, err);
1164 if (ce_show_data && ecc->flt_addr != AFLT_INV_ADDR)
1299 aflt->flt_addr
1872 cpu_get_mem_offset(uint64_t flt_addr, uint64_t *offp) argument
[all...]
H A Dus3_common.c1219 aflt->flt_addr = t_afar;
1387 aflt->flt_addr = t_afar;
1679 aflt->flt_addr = t_afar;
1817 aflt->flt_addr = t_afar;
2111 aflt->flt_addr = iparity ? (uint64_t)tpc : AFLT_INV_ADDR;
2434 if (page_retire_check(aflt->flt_addr, NULL) == 0) {
2472 if (page_retire_check(aflt->flt_addr, &errors) == EINVAL) {
2508 if (page_retire_check(aflt->flt_addr, NULL) == 0) {
2510 softcall(ecc_page_zero, (void *)aflt->flt_addr);
2547 if (aflt->flt_addr !
3456 cpu_get_mem_offset(uint64_t flt_addr, uint64_t *offp) argument
3478 cpu_get_mem_unum(int synd_status, ushort_t flt_synd, uint64_t flt_stat, uint64_t flt_addr, int flt_bus_id, int flt_in_memory, ushort_t flt_status, char *buf, int buflen, int *lenp) argument
[all...]
/illumos-gate/usr/src/uts/sun4u/daktari/os/
H A Ddaktari.c537 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
541 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
/illumos-gate/usr/src/uts/sun4u/starcat/os/
H A Dstarcat.c1058 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
1068 return (p2get_mem_unum(synd_code, P2ALIGN(flt_addr, 8),
1075 P2ALIGN(flt_addr, 8), buf, buflen, lenp)) != 0)
/illumos-gate/usr/src/uts/common/io/pciex/
H A Dpcie_fault.c2543 uint64_t flt_addr = 0; local
2557 flt_addr = ((uint64_t)adv_reg_p->pcie_ue_hdr[2] << 32);
2558 flt_addr |= adv_reg_p->pcie_ue_hdr[3];
2560 flt_addr = adv_reg_p->pcie_ue_hdr[2];
2585 flt_addr = 0;
2594 flt_addr = NULL;
2614 adv_reg_p->pcie_ue_tgt_addr = flt_addr;
/illumos-gate/usr/src/uts/sun4u/serengeti/os/
H A Dserengeti.c925 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
950 P2ALIGN(flt_addr, 8), buf, buflen, lenp));
952 return (unum_func(synd_code, P2ALIGN(flt_addr, 8),
968 P2ALIGN(flt_addr, 8), buf, buflen, lenp) != 0) {
972 return (sg_get_ecacheunum(flt_bus_id, flt_addr,
/illumos-gate/usr/src/uts/sun4u/lw8/os/
H A Dlw8_platmod.c935 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
960 P2ALIGN(flt_addr, 8), buf, buflen, lenp));
962 return (unum_func(synd_code, P2ALIGN(flt_addr, 8),
978 P2ALIGN(flt_addr, 8), buf, buflen, lenp) != 0) {
982 return (sg_get_ecacheunum(flt_bus_id, flt_addr,
/illumos-gate/usr/src/uts/sun4u/opl/os/
H A Dopl.c863 plat_get_mem_unum(int synd_code, uint64_t flt_addr, int flt_bus_id, argument
872 return (opl_get_mem_unum(synd_code, flt_addr, buf,
/illumos-gate/usr/src/uts/sun4u/opl/io/
H A Dmc-opl.c2983 mc_get_mem_unum(int synd_code, uint64_t flt_addr, char *buf, int buflen, argument
2997 if (((mcp = mc_pa_to_mcp(flt_addr)) == NULL) ||
2998 (!pa_is_valid(mcp, flt_addr))) {
3009 bank = pa_to_bank(mcp, flt_addr - mcp->mc_start_address);
3011 cs = pa_to_cs(mcp, flt_addr - mcp->mc_start_address);

Completed in 316 milliseconds